Converting 48 inches to centimeters results in 121.92 cm.
Since 1 inch equals 2.54 centimeters, multiplying 48 inches by 2.54 gives the length in centimeters. So, 48 inches times 2.54 equals 121.92 cm, which is the converted length in metric units.

Conversion Formula
The formula to convert inches to centimeters is simple: multiply the number of inches by 2.54, because 1 inch equals 2.54 centimeters. For example, if you want to convert 10 inches, you do 10 * 2.54 = 25.4 cm. This works because the centimeter is a metric unit defined as 1/100 of a meter, and inches are an imperial measurement.

Conversion Definitions
inch
An inch is a unit of length in the imperial system, measuring exactly 2.54 centimeters, used mainly in the United States and the UK for measuring height, length, or distance in various contexts like construction, manufacturing, and everyday measurements.
cm
Centimeter, abbreviated as cm, is a metric unit of length equal to one hundredth of a meter, used worldwide to measure small distances or objects, common in scientific, medical, and everyday measurements due to its precision and simplicity.
Conversion FAQs
What is the most common use of inches in measurement?
Inches are most commonly used to measure height, width, or length of objects in construction, tailoring, and manufacturing, especially in countries like the United States where imperial units are prevalent.
How precise is the inch-to-cm conversion?
The conversion from inches to centimeters is exact, based on the defined value of 1 inch as 2.54 centimeters. This means calculations are accurate to the four decimal places provided, ensuring consistency in measurements.
Can I convert inches to centimeters with a calculator instead of a formula?
Yes, you can simply multiply the number of inches by 2.54 using a calculator or the conversion tool provided, which automates the process and reduces chances of errors for quick conversions.
